UK TO TOUGHEN TERRORISM SENTENCING

The UK government says it will tighten the system for dealing with people convicted of terrorism offences.

It comes after a man was shot dead in South London on Sunday after attacking people with a knife, while wearing a fake suicide vest.

Sudesh Amman was released from prison a week ago after serving half his sentence for terror offences.

It comes just months after 2019's London Bridge attack which saw two people stabbed to death by a man who'd been released from jail on licence - also after serving half his sentence for a terrorism conviction.

Former UK national anti-terrorism co-ordinator Nick Aldworth thinks the government's response is too simplistic.

Thai coronavirus patient responds to new drug mix

Thai doctors have successfully treated a patient with a serious case of coronavirus at a Bangkok hospital. The flu drug oseltamivir, used to treat Middle East Respiratory Syndrome (Mers) and HIV treatments lopinavir and ritonavir were used in combination producing rapid results in the patient.

Key witness testifies in Weinstein rape trial

A key witness in the trial of Harvey Weinstein has taken to the stand
accusing him of rape and sexual assault.

Over 80 women accuse the movie mogul of sexual misconduct but this
trial centers around accusations from two women.

Weinstein has pleaded not guilty to five felony charges and insists
all his sexual encounters have been consensual.

As William Denselow reports from New York, Weinstein could face life
in prison if convicted.
